Output 99be322651403f4682d4b5d7c4c85807182315e5c0e23b34100bc03fd82e5cd6:0

value
17020746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9dbb4847c8ea88c6528df03607d2763bc33c9c OP_EQUAL
address
3QdSV5JHGCrX8fRYCkDGrt1AAUYG3sHtB5
transaction
99be322651403f4682d4b5d7c4c85807182315e5c0e23b34100bc03fd82e5cd6
spent
true